Josip Josifovski is a research assistant at the Chair for Robotics, Artificial Intelligence and Real-Time systems at the Technical University of Munich. He received his master’s degree in Intelligent Adaptive Systems from the University of Hamburg in 2018 and his bachelor’s degree in Informatics and Computer Engineering from the Ss. Cyril and Methodius University in Skopje in 2012. At his current position, he is working within the Artificial Intelligence for Digitizing Industry (AI4DI) research project, where he develops simulations and artificial intelligence algorithms for industrial robots. His research focus is on continual reinforcement learning, simulations and sim2real transfer in robotics. His previous experience includes research work on cross-modal learning in robotics with the Knowledge Technology group at the University of Hamburg and several years of industry experience in startup and mid-size companies focusing on software development, computer vision and augmented reality.
